Best Western Hotels
Best Western International is the world’s largest hotel chain with more than 4,200 hotels in more than 80 countries.

In 1946 Merrill K. Guertin began an informal link with other out of state properties, to recommend each other to travelers. By 1962 there were 670 properties in 25 states and Canada. In 1976 Best Western went international with agreements with 411 properties in Australia and New Zealand. In 1978 expansion into European began with hotels in the UK and Ireland.
Today there are over 4,200 properties in over 80 countries worldwide, making Best Western the largest hotel chain around the globe.

At the end of the 2005 fiscal year, Best Western had 2,398 hotels in North America. Best Western welcomed 344 new hotels worldwide, and 146 of these properties are based in North America.

Best Western has 19 international affiliate offices and property-direct relationships with another six regions. Recently, Best Western welcomed the new countries and territories of Malaysia and Suriname. Best Western International provides reservation and brand identity services for all of its 4,200 hotels worldwide.

Best Western has multilingual, consolidated reservation and operation centers in Phoenix, Arizona; Milan, Italy and Manila, Philippines.

Best Western also handles reservations through its website at www.bestwestern.com®. Special site features include a complete hotel guide, trip planner and a section for travel planners. In time for the 2006 summer travel season, consumers booking at www.bestwestern.com will be able to view five distinct virtual tours for every Best Western hotel in the U.S., Canada and the Caribbean. Each property will feature a 360-degree display of the hotel’s exterior, a standard guest room, and a deluxe room/suite, in addition to two other areas representative of the property, such as a pool, meeting room or restaurant.

On average, bestwestern.com has been booking $1 million in revenue per day for the hotel chain since January 2005.
 
About the Best Western Amrutha Castle

complete getaway from mundane business class hotels – a centrally located 4 star boutique hotel in the city of pearls and minarets – Hyderabad. Built on the lines of a Bavarian Castle-Schloss Neushwanstien, this abode of royal luxury and gorgeous grandeurs is constructed in medieval European architectural style and is in front of the Andhra Pradesh State Secretariat, Hyderabad, with the magnificent Birla Mandir in the background. The hotel is a franchisee of Best Western International Inc. U.S.A.

It has been fashioned to give a rustic, country look complete with wooden beams and wooden flooring, with sophisticated facilities and a friendly staff waiting in attendance to make you feel like the royal one. It covers 65,000 Sq.ft of built up area and comprises of 90 well appointed, centrally air-conditioned rooms, straight out of King Arthur's Camelot.

The interior was designed with the Knights in shining armours imported from Spain and with the stained glass from Holland. Mr. Francois Grenier and Mr.Silvio created the unique Fish Fountain in the Atrium. The fish statue and the surrounding granite benches and planters had been sculpted under the guidance of Mr. Francois Grenier.
